Marcus Lindblomis a heck of a guy. Every time you think he’s let loose everything there is to tell about taking Shigesato Itoi’sMother 2and transforming it intoEarthBound, he pulls out some new stories to shares. Right now he’s running a Kickstarter for a RTS calledThe RobotApocalypse, but the subject ofEarthBoundfollows him wherever he goes.

He’s got some interesting insights on giving the game’s religious cult a less KKK-style, more Santa-influenced look, how the “just say no” anti-drug campaign of the time influenced how stores were named, and a lot more. His daughter Nico also jumps in with some words about her experience with both being inEarthBound, and playing it herself.
